Felix Queißner’s Ashet Dwelling Laptop Is a Raspberry Pi RP2350-Powered Love Letter to the ’80s



Classic computing fanatic Felix Queißner is engaged on a modular house microcomputer, impressed by traditional computer systems of the Eighties — and powered by the Raspberry Pi RP2350 dual-core dual-architecture microcontroller, linked to 8MB of pseudo-static RAM (PSRAM).

“The Ashet Dwelling Laptop bridges the hole between easy microcontroller growth boards and fashionable single-board computer systems, providing the processing functionality to run a full graphical desktop OS whereas sustaining the {hardware} accessibility of less complicated methods,” Queißner guarantees of the system. “Constructed across the [Raspberry Pi] RP2350 dual-core processor, it combines enough computational energy for a contemporary consumer interface with a clear, education-oriented structure. The modular growth system, impressed by traditional pc designs, permits direct {hardware} entry whereas offering correct driver abstractions for portability.”

Whereas the Raspberry Pi RP2350, with its two Arm Cortex-M33 and two free and open supply RISC-V Hazard3 cores operating at as much as 150MHz, is a really fashionable piece of kit, Queißner’s inspiration calls again to the modular microcomputers of the Seventies and Eighties — together with the enduring Altair 8800, launched in 1974 and well-known for kick-starting the non-public computing revolution and setting the stage for Microsoft’s success within the working system market.

A inventory ABS case homes the modules, together with a core module that pairs the Raspberry Pi RP2350 with 8MB of pseudo-static RAM (PSRAM), 16MB of flash storage, a USB 1.1 host port, Quick Ethernet connectivity, a battery-backed real-time clock, and an built-in debug probe. Seven growth slots are offered, with designs at the moment together with a video card able to 640×400 at 60Hz with eight bits per pixel colour, a PCM soundcard with 16-bit 48kHz enter and output capabilities, a USB card with 4 USB 1.1 Host ports, a “Fundamental I/O” card with eight general-purpose enter/output (GPIO) pins and an I2C bus, a “Commodore Connectivity Card” that gives two serial ports appropriate with Commodore 64 and Commodore 128 equipment, and a perfboard “Person Enlargement Card” for {custom} add-ons.

The system is designed to run Ashet OS, a primary working system impressed by Amiga Workbench. “It’s an experiment in simplicity, approachability, and fashionable design,” Queißner claims, “constructed to show that you may have a responsive, hackable, and moveable OS — with out bloated complexity or pointless limitations. Whether or not you are a curious hacker, retro computing fanatic, or simply somebody uninterested in ready on fashionable machines, Ashet OS goals to encourage and empower.”

Queißner has shared screenshots, renders, and a few case mock-up images on the undertaking’s web site; he says that “a practical cable litter prototype” that is ready to boot into the working system and launch functions has been constructed, with the following stage within the course of being design for manufacturing forward of a deliberate launch.

“One of many objectives is to make the pc obtainable for €250 (round $300) or much less,” Queißner says, “but when that is attainable will depend on so many particulars that it’s onerous to inform within the present section. It doesn’t matter what’s the result of this section, the entire pc design might be obtainable free of charge beneath a permissive license and will be constructed by everybody.
